Chemical Kinetics – Detailed Notes (Class 11)
Introduction
1 Chemical kinetics studies the rate of chemical reactions.
2 It helps understand how fast or slow a reaction occurs.
Rate of Reaction
1 Rate = Change in concentration / Time
2 It decreases with time as reactants are used up.
Factors Affecting Rate
1 Concentration: More particles → more collisions
2 Temperature: Higher temperature → more energy
3 Catalyst: Provides alternate path
4 Surface Area: More exposed area increases rate
Rate Law
1 Rate = k[A]^m[B]^n
2 k is rate constant
3 m and n are orders determined experimentally
